Introduction
The Snowy Mountains, located in the southeastern region of New South Wales, Australia, are part of the Great Dividing Range. This spectacular mountain range is home to Australia's highest peak, Mount Kosciuszko, standing at 2,228 meters (7,310 feet) above sea level. The region is a popular tourist destination throughout the seasons and offers a wide range of activities for visitors to enjoy.
Getting There
The Snowy Mountains are accessible by car, bus, or train. The closest airports are Canberra and Cooma, and both offer rental car services. From Sydney, the drive to the Snowy Mountains is approximately 5 hours. From Melbourne, it is approximately 6 hours.
Things to Do
- Skiing and Snowboarding: The Snowy Mountains are renowned for their ski resorts, which are open from June to October. Thredbo, Perisher, and Charlotte Pass are three of the most popular resorts.
- Hiking: The Snowy Mountains offer numerous hiking trails that vary in difficulty and length. The most popular route is the Mount Kosciuszko Summit Walk, which takes you to the highest peak in Australia.
- Mountain Biking: The region has a vast network of mountain bike trails suitable for all levels of cyclists.
- Fishing: The Snowy Mountains have an abundance of lakes and streams, making it a popular destination for fishing enthusiasts. The region is particularly known for its trout fishing.
- Water Sports: During the summer months, the region's lakes and rivers are perfect for recreational activities such as canoeing, kayaking, and stand-up paddleboarding.

Weather
The Snowy Mountains experience cold winters and mild summers. The best time to visit for skiing and snowboarding is between June and August, and the best time for outdoor activities such as hiking and fishing is between December and March, when the weather is milder.
